Subject: Yeah I hear you buddy, but you might be suprised.


My brother and I are young farmers as well and we constantly worry about our crops. Maybe it's because our debt load is very heavy or we just feel like we have to prove something. With the way the year has been I feel that it's in gods hands now. We've done all we can in replanting corn, beans and even some milo, and have been blessed with some rain to carry the late crops along, I look at some of my corn I didn't replant and worry that it won't do much, but how am I supposed to know for sure? We picked some terrible looking corn last year, and somehow it still made 117 bpa, don't know how. My solution now is to wait for the combining to start then I'll know. I know I've done all I can do for the year we have had. I feel that scouting crops is important however, the crops that are already made, maybe not so much, but in the last three years it seems like we are always battling bugs, or something that could mess your yield up if you don't catch it in time. So if I can offer any advice, young farmer to young farmer, it would be to stay alert on the crops that are already made, and don't worry about the one's that you know are already made. Good luck man, I bet you'll be just fine. Just get your equipment ready and be ready to get going when you can.
